Donnafugata is one of the 50 best wine tourism destinations in the world

The Sicilian company in the World’s Best Vineyards 2022

Donnafugata and Sicilian quality wines have reached a new prestigious achievement. As it was announced yesterday in Mendoza, Argentina, the World’s Best Vineyards Academy has placed Donnafugata for the first time in the world’s 50 most popular wineries, in terms of the overall visiting experience and the tastings offered to its customers.

The strict evaluation criteria take into account the quality of the wine, the tasting particularities, the professionality of the hospitality staff as well as the beauty of the winery.

In this year’s Top 50, Donnafugata has been prized for its historical cellars in Marsala; the company has entered the World’s Best Vineyards for the wonderful underground barrique cellar, the authentic Sicilian hospitality style and its original wine tastings: from the sophisticated wine-food pairings to the multisensory experience of music and wine.

“It’s great news for Donnafugata and our beloved island,” commented José and Antonio Rallo. “The Academy has appreciated our distinctive trait focused on the dialogue between wine and art: from the discovery of the territories to the wines, from our artistic labels to music, these elements are all combined to create and unforgettable experience, always captivating for wine tourists visiting us from all over the world.”

“It’s a big accomplishment – points out Francesco Ferreri, who oversees wine tourism at Donnafugata – achieved thanks to a team of competent and passionate people capable of telling Donnafugata’s Sicily: from Mount Etna to the island of Pantelleria, from Contessa Entellina to Vittoria, and up to Marsala’s historical winery. This award encourages us to promote wine culture even more and conveys our vision as a company that aims to excellence in its tours as well as in successful wine tourism events such as Cantine Aperte and Calici di Stelle.”

The 600 judges of the World’s Best Vineyards Academy – wine, travel, and wine tourism experts, coming from 22 different countries – have evaluated the quality of the visiting experience offered by wineries from all over the world, and in 2022 only 3 Italian wineries were recognized with this prestigious award.
